What is involved in repairing a garage door screen?

Repairing a garage door screen typically involves patching small tears or replacing sections of torn mesh. Specialists will ensure the screen material is properly re-secured to the frame, checking for any loose edges or gaps that could allow insects to enter. If the frame itself is damaged, they can often repair or reinforce it. The goal is to restore the screen's integrity, providing a barrier against pests while allowing airflow.

What factors influence the cost of a garage door spring replacement?

The cost of a garage door spring replacement is primarily influenced by the type of springs needed (torsion or extension), the number of springs, and their specific size and strength. Labor costs can also vary depending on the accessibility of the springs and any additional work required, such as adjusting cables or the opener. What are the common issues with wall mount garage door openers?

Common issues with wall mount garage door openers can include problems with the motor, the internal gear assembly, or the wiring that controls its operation. The sensors can also develop issues, requiring realignment or replacement. Like any mechanical device, wear and tear over time can lead to malfunctions.
